Objective
THE PREDICTIBILITY OF ANY MODEL OF GENERAL ATMOSPHERIC CIRCULATION CAN BE ASSESSED THROUGH ITS CAPACITY OF SIMULATING WELL-KNOWN CLIMATIC SITUATIONS WIDELY DIFFERENT FROM THOSE PREVAILING TO-DAY. IT IS PROPOSED TO COLLECT PRECISE POLLENANALYTICAL QUANTITATIVE DATA CONCERNING THE LAST INTERGLACIAL OPTIMUM (AROUND 120.000 B.P.) IN TWO EUROPEAN SITES AND TO APPLY TO THESE DATA THE TYPE OF TRANSFER FUNCTIONS WHICH HAVE BEEN WORKED OUT IN A RESEARCH, NOW IN PROCESS OF ACHIEVEMENT, CONCERNING THE LAST GLACIAL PERIOD MADE CONJOINTLY WITH THE LABORATOIRE DE PALYNOLOGIE DE L'UNIVERSITE DES SCIENCES ET TECHNIQUES DU LANGUEDOC (MONTPELLIER) AND THE LABORATOIRE DE STATISTIQUES DE L'UNIVERSITE PARIS VI.
THE FINAL AIM SHOULD BE TO PROVIDE CONTINENTAL CLIMATIC PARAMETERS ENABLING ALL THE CLIMATE MODELLERS TO TEST THEIR PRODUCTS WITH REGARD TO CLIMATIC SITUATIONS UNAFFECTED BY MAN'S ACTION, WELL CONTRASTING WITH EACH OTHER AND DIFFERENT FROM THE PRESENT CLIMATE.
